> The problem here is this:
> {noformat}
>   } else if (ttype->is_list() || ttype->is_set()) {
>     t_type* etype = ((t_list*)ttype)->get_elem_type();
> {noformat}
> {{ttype}} cannot necessarily be cast to {{t_list*}}, since sometimes it is a {{t_set*}}. When it is a {{t_set*}}, the call to {{get_elem_type()}} is undefined behavior: section 9.3.1 "Nonstatic member functions \[class.mfct.non-static\]", paragraph 2 of the C++14 standard states "If a non-static member function of a class X is called for an object that is not of type X, or of a type derived from X, the behavior is undefined."
> This will be tough to fix completely, since one of these is an error in Boost that is present all the way through the latest Boost that is a vendor-supplied Ubuntu 14.04 package.
